Standard Details

Reference
104
Level
Level 5
Typical Duration
24 months
Sector
Business and administration
Description
Managing teams and projects in line with a private, public, or voluntary organisation's operational or departmental strategy.

Funding

Maximum Funding Band
£9,000
Levy Employers
Fund directly from apprenticeship levy account
Non-Levy (Co-Investment)
Employer pays 5% (£450), government funds rest
